I just switched to a Pixel 10a from an iPhone 15 Pro Max and honestly, don't regret it. by Skylius23 in pixel_phones

[–]Skylius23[S] 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Honeymoon phase probably over, I haven't noticed anything missable. I sort of missed the media player in the dynamic island but I legit just installed an app for that and it works fine, looks good. App polish in some places is still behind iOS, mainly apps that don't use a react native to give similar experience. I'm talking niche situations though, and when it is different, it's not terrible, it's just different.

This phone has its -isms just like any phone would but they erk me way less than the shit piling up on iOS. The camera isn't anything stunning but it does have more personality than a picture from my iPhone would have, almost retro? But still takes great photos, it's just the color balancing feels more human and less robotic. The plastic back has been weirdly durable (I've been using this thing naked as cases are scarce in brick in mortar stores) my biggest recommendation is to buy a screen protector but it does get micro scratches a little easier than my iPhone did. But besides that it's been a really nice phone, you won't realize it until after you get the phone how nice something flat feels in your pocket. I've been hyper obsessed over the lack of a camera bump more than noticing performance issues.

Most little games I play work perfectly, and a lot that I didn't expect to run well, ended up running fantastically. The performance benchmarks are null & void in my opinion, this phone rocks and the bonehead that told me this phones a downgrade needs to reconsider people's needs before their own.

Overall, would buy another pixel 10a for family to get them off iPhones lol.

In the future I don't even think if I had the money I would consider upgrading to a higher end model, Google figured out budget and I think it's mostly due to software optimization over raw performance.

I switched from an iPhone 15 Pro Max to a Pixel 10a, and believe me when I say I actually prefer it. As someone who mostly just reads and listens to music, I have no clue why I was even using a flagship.

I’ve been told it’s a downgrade or a sidegrade, but the battery life is great and the phone is very capable for my tasks. My issue with the 15PM, besides a degrading battery, was the software; iOS has gotten messy. There are plenty of things it does well, and I still have the muscle memory from using an iPhone for years, but it’s gotten buggier with every update. (The keyboard typeface disappearing in native apps was what finally made me switch!)

Life with the 10a has been refreshing. Things have been working well and feel snappy. I haven’t really noticed any of the "shortcomings" I was warned about. And yes, I’m a big fan of the flat back.
